Before you had to either know how to give bearings/directions to people not close to you or you had to be sort of close so that you could communicate enemy positions well.
It was actually a skill in and of itself to be able to communicate effectively.
Now you can play far more spread out, far more aggressively with fast easy and accurate marks for your entire squad, which like Miller said makes artillery waaaaaaaaaaaay too easy to use and basically takes the minimal amount of skill required to use it before away.
I get that a ping system lowers the barrier to entry and lets people without mics play but who plays HLL to play with a bunch of mutes - without comms HLL is pretty ♥♥♥♥, it doesnt function they ways its intended too.
The thought of catering and thus introducing more mutes hurts the rest of the playerbase.
